UFC 297: Strickland vs. du Plessis, a highly anticipated event in the world of mixed martial arts, is set to deliver an action-packed lineup of fights. With the battle set for Saturday, January 20, 2024, at the Scotiabank Arena in Toronto, Ontario, Canada and airing on ESPN+, this event marks a significant return for the UFC to Toronto after several years and the promotion’s first show there since the pandemic.

The main event features a gripping Middleweight Title Bout between the reigning champion Sean Strickland and the formidable challenger Dricus du Plessis. Additionally, the fight card boasts a Women’s Bantamweight Title Bout for the vacant title between Raquel Pennington and Mayra Bueno Silva, adding to the night’s allure. With fighters hailing from different parts of the world, UFC 297 is a balanced event featuring all the styles that keep MMA fans coming back for more.

When to Watch

Early prelims are available at 6:30 PM EST. The event itself kicks off with the prelims starting at 8:00 PM EST, followed by the main card at 10:00 PM EST. From start to finish, the night looks to offer a unique blend of technique, power, and resilience.

How to Watch

MMA enthusiasts have the opportunity to stream all the UFC action on Saturdays via ESPN+. This pay per view is available to current subscribers for $79.99. For new subscribers, the event with an annual ESPN+ subscription is $134.98 . It’s accessible on various devices including Roku, Fire TV, Apple TV, and others compatible with ESPN+.

The early prelims will air on ESPN+ and UFC Fight Pass, and the prelims will air on ESPNEWS which you can watch on DIRECTV STREAMFuboHulu + Live TVSling TV, and YouTube TV on Roku, Fire TV, Apple TV, or any other compatible device.

The Fight Card

Early Preliminary Card (ESPN+ / UFC Fight Pass) – Begins at 6:30 PM EST

  • Welterweight Bout: Yohan Lainesse vs. Sam Patterson
  • Women’s Flyweight Bout: Jasmine Jasudavicius vs. Priscila Cachoeira
  • Flyweight Bout: Malcolm Gordon vs. Jimmy Flick

Preliminary Card (ESPNews / ESPN+) – Begins at 8:00 PM EST

  • Bantamweight Bout: Brad Katona vs. Garrett Armfield
  • Featherweight Bout: Charles Jourdain vs. Sean Woodson
  • Bantamweight Bout: Serhiy Sidey vs. Ramon Taveras
  • Women’s Strawweight Bout: Gillian Robertson vs. Polyana Viana

Main Card (ESPN+) – Begins at 10:00 PM EST

  • Middleweight Title Bout: Sean Strickland vs. Dricus du Plessis
  • Women’s Bantamweight Title Bout: Raquel Pennington vs. Mayra Bueno Silva
  • Welterweight Bout: Neil Magny vs. Mike Malott
  • Middleweight Bout: Chris Curtis vs. Marc-André Barriault
  • Featherweight Bout: Arnold Allen vs. Movsar Evloev
